Injured Great Horned Owl Tries to Outrun Colorado Wildlife Officials

It was a game of cat and mouse when a Colorado Parks and Wildlife officer tried to capture an injured Great Horned Owl. The owl tried and tried to outrun Officer McDowell, but she eventually closed in. The organization said the animal couldn’t fly away because its wing was severely injured. And its noticeable uneven pupils indicate that it had possible head trauma. Inside Edition Digital has more.
